But today, to celebrate seeing Carrie Underwood at Ravinia, I'd like to talk about music & running.  When I injured myself back in April, I first blamed it on the city of Chicago for not fixing the running path and then on myself because I got so caught up in my music and forgot to pay attention to what was going on around me.  After my sprain, I started running sans music and I surprisingly enjoyed it.  With the wedding just around the corner, I had enough thoughts to keep myself entertained :-) But when I signed up for this half marathon with my friend, I knew I'd need some music to help power me through my long runs.  
The Friday before the race, I made sure to update my 1/2 marathon playlist with some new favorites.  In total I had about 42 songs.  I won't list all 42, but I will list the ones that motivated me to get running again or run just a little bit faster.
